Copacabana Hosts Monument in Honor of Ayrton Senna

RIO DE JANEIRO, BRAZIL - The bronze work is the product of artist Mario Pitanguy, and will be on an 80cm podium-shaped stand, designed by engineer Anderson Pereira, for an Urban Hotel campaign.

Pitanguy, who was out of the country when he was invited to sculpt the Brazilian pilot who made history in Formula 1, took six months to finish the work and speaks of his pride in executing it.
